Student parties and the BSA: new EM TV broadcast
The television broadcasts of Erasmus Magazine will be back from Thursday. This week’s topic: the student parties during the pandemic are a big problem for the police. The community police officer from Erasmus University Shelley will be a guest in the studio on Thursday. And reporter Michelle Frijters spoke to students on campus about the binding study advice: should it be relaxed because of corona or not?

At the known time (09.00 a.m.) the broadcast will go live under the new name EM TV. It is also possible to watch the episode immediately afterwards.
News, human interest, all kinds of topics and themes can be expected at EM TV. Feba Sukmana and Tessa Hofland will take care of the presentation of the programme.
